Redux — Значение слова

Слово «redux» происходит от латинского глагола «reducere», что означает «возвращать» или «возвращаться». В современном русском языке это слово чаще всего используется в значении «возвращение к прежнему состоянию» или «возвращение к исходному пути». Однако, в последнее время оно приобрело новое значение благодаря популярности одноименной библиотеки для управления состоянием приложения — Redux.
Redux — это инструмент, который помогает организовать и управлять состоянием приложения в единой централизованной точке. В основе его работы лежит принцип однонаправленного потока данных, который позволяет отслеживать и изменять состояние приложения в едином месте. Это позволяет упростить разработку и поддержку приложения, а также повысить его производительность.
Одним из ключевых понятий в Redux является «хранилище» (store). Оно представляет собой объект, который содержит в себе все данные приложения. Любые изменения в состоянии приложения происходят путем отправки «действий» (actions) в хранилище. Действия — это простые объекты, которые описывают, какое изменение нужно произвести в состоянии. Затем, с помощью «редьюсеров» (reducers), которые являются чистыми функциями, происходит обработка действий и изменение состояния в хранилище.
Таким образом, Redux позволяет разделить логику приложения и управление состоянием. Это делает код более понятным и поддерживаемым, а также упрощает отладку и тестирование. Кроме того, благодаря централизованному хранению данных, приложение становится более предсказуемым и устойчивым к ошибкам.
В заключение, можно сказать, что значение слова «redux» теперь прочно связано с понятием управления состоянием приложения. Это мощный инструмент, который помогает разработчикам создавать более эффективные и надежные приложения. И хотя оно может показаться сложным для новичков, освоить Redux стоит, чтобы улучшить качество и производительность своих проектов.

Значения слов